lets just say when I left the workshop I really did not notice any difference. The car was alot smoother and tighter but feel that was down to the full inspection 2.
Having now done nearly 200 miles the car is amazing, its delivery of power is sensational and having just got back from taking a mate out it seems even quicker.
I can not recommend evolve enough, They have told me that the remap will take a few hundred miles to settle in properly and have a big enough effect on the BHP.
I was quite pleased with the Dyno results kicking out a true 311 bhp which without the remap being taken into account is good, Evolve reckon by the time the miles have passed and the car is not running rich it will settle around the 320 bhp, by that time I will put the Simota airfilter on it and hopefully should be seeing as near to 330 as possible.
Best money spent, Just wish I hadnt had to throw 1k at new breaks earlier in the week.
